Key Points

  • Location: Performed at London’s historic Piccadilly Theatre, right in the heart of the West End.
  • Cost: Approximately $45.92 per ticket, offering good value for a top-tier theatrical experience.
  • Duration: Around 2 hours and 45 minutes, including breaks for a full evening’s entertainment.
  • Highlights: Spectacular set designs, talented singers, dancers, and a reinvention of a well-loved film musical.
  • Accessibility: Near public transportation, suitable for most travelers, children aged 12 and up.
  • Note: Uses strobe lighting, so check if this impacts your viewing comfort.

Is the ticket price all-inclusive?
Yes, the price covers your admission to the show. Food and drinks are not included, so plan to enjoy a meal or drinks before or after if desired.

Can I choose my seat when booking?
Absolutely. Booking online allows you to select your preferred seat category and specific seating to ensure the best possible view.

How long is the show?
The performance runs approximately 2 hours and 45 minutes, including any intervals.

Is the show suitable for children?
Yes, it’s suitable for children aged 12 and up. Keep in mind the show uses strobe lighting, which might affect sensitive viewers.

What is the cancellation policy?
The ticket is non-refundable and cannot be changed once purchased, so double-check your plans before buying.

Is transportation to the theatre easy?
Yes, the Piccadilly Theatre is near public transportation, making it easy to reach from most parts of London.
